When converting between currencies with different minor-unit precision (for example, between two- and zero-decimal currencies), the service applies banker's rounding after the rate multiplication, never before. Do not re-round on the client side; the response is authoritative. Discrepancies larger than one minor unit should be reported to the platform team. To call the sandbox conversion endpoint during onboarding, authenticate with the internal key provided below.

gateway credential: kto23_LX9A4ys6i4nzHtpOLNLodKK

Subject: Tracing setup for the Quillbrook integration

Hi, and welcome aboard. As you wire your services into the Quillbrook mesh, please propagate our trace header on every outbound call, including retries — dropped headers are the main reason spans appear orphaned in the Lanternview dashboard. Sampling is set to 20% in staging, so don't panic if some requests vanish. To query the trace API directly while you're validating your integration, authenticate with the token below.

login token, yagaf-hawip: eyJhbGciOiJIUzI1NiIsInR5cCI6IkpXVCJ9.eyJzdWIiOiIdHjlcNIn0.AFyH-u9q

Finance Review Summary — Retirement of the Orlin Compact Line

Prepared for the board of Hartquist Manufacturing. The Orlin Compact line will be wound down over two quarters; margins have fallen below 8% amid rising component costs from the Velmora supplier base. Inventory will be liquidated through regional discounters, with tooling redeployed to the Asterley plant. Write-downs are within reserve. Rationale follows below.

confidential, kagep-kahof: Druokax Systems plans to lower the Ulaath list price by 53 percent in March.

Handover note — Crumbwheel order cutoffs.

Welcome aboard. The bakery cutoff rule in Crumbwheel closes same-day orders at 14:00 local to each storefront, not UTC — this has bitten us twice. Holiday overrides live in the calendar service and take precedence silently, so always check there first when a cutoff looks wrong. To unlock the calendar service's admin console after a restart, enter the recovery passphrase below.

vault phrase of bagap-bahaf = silion-pelox-sorox-casdor-quenwyn-fraax-eliox-praael-kelion-quenvan-kasox-rusael-norius-belvan